Ingredients You’ll Need
- 1 pound boneless skinless chicken breasts: Tender chicken is essential for this dish; the slow cooking makes it juicy. You could also use thighs for a richer flavor.
- 8 ounce can water chestnuts: They add a delightful crunch to contrast the tender chicken.
- 1/4 cup soy sauce: Use low-sodium soy sauce for a healthier option without compromising flavor.
- 1/4 cup honey: The natural sweetness of honey balances the saltiness of the soy sauce perfectly.
- 2 tablespoons seedless blackberry jam: This adds a unique fruity twist; feel free to swap it for another fruit jam if preferred.
- 1 tablespoon cornstarch: This helps thicken the sauce, giving it a glossy finish.
- 2 teaspoons minced garlic: Fresh garlic provides a robust flavor, enhancing the overall taste.
- 1/2 teaspoon chili garlic sauce: For a hint of heat that brings the dish to life; adjust to your spice preference.
- 1/2 teaspoon garlic powder: A great complement to the fresh garlic, creating depth of flavor.
How to Make Slow Cooker Honey Garlic Chicken
Prep the Chicken: Start by cutting 1 pound of boneless skinless chicken breasts into small bite-sized pieces. This ensures even cooking and makes it easier to eat later.
Prepare the Water Chestnuts: Open the 8-ounce can of water chestnuts, drain them, and finely dice them. This will add a nice crunch to your dish.
Combine Chicken and Water Chestnuts: Place the diced chicken and water chestnuts directly into your slow cooker. Give them a gentle toss to mix.
Make the Sauce: In a small bowl, whisk together 1/4 cup soy sauce, 1/4 cup honey, 2 tablespoons seedless blackberry jam, 1 tablespoon cornstarch, 2 teaspoons minced garlic, and 1/2 teaspoon chili garlic sauce. This harmonious blend of flavors will enhance your chicken.
Add Sauce to the Slow Cooker: Pour the sauce over the chicken and water chestnuts in the slow cooker. Stir to ensure everything is well coated.
Cook: Set your slow cooker to low and let it cook for 6-8 hours or on high for about 3-4 hours. You’ll know it’s ready when the chicken is tender, and the sauce has thickened nicely.
Storing & Reheating
Store any leftover Slow Cooker Honey Garlic Chicken in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 4 days. For long-term storage, you can freeze it in a freezer-safe container for up to 3 months. When reheating, warm it gently on the stovetop over low heat or in the microwave until heated through. The texture may slightly change after freezing, but adding a splash of water or broth while reheating can help revive the sauce’s consistency.
Chef’s Helpful Tips
- Avoid overcooking the chicken to prevent it from becoming dry; make sure to check for doneness based on cooking time.
- Let the chicken rest for a few minutes before serving—this allows the juices to redistribute.
- For a thicker sauce, mix an additional teaspoon of cornstarch with water and add it during the last 30 minutes of cooking.
- Customize your dish by adding vegetables like bell peppers or snap peas in the last hour of cooking for added nutrition and color.
- If you’re short on time, diced chicken can be used directly from the freezer. Just remember to extend the cooking time!

Recipe FAQs
Can I use frozen chicken in this recipe?
Absolutely! You can use frozen chicken directly in the slow cooker, but be sure to extend the cooking time. It may take an additional hour on low or about 30 minutes on high. Just make sure to monitor the temperature to ensure it’s cooked through.
How can I make this dish spicier?
If you love a good kick, you can up the ante by adding more chili garlic sauce or incorporating fresh sliced chilies. For a smoky flavor, consider a dash of smoked paprika as well.
What can I serve with Slow Cooker Honey Garlic Chicken?
This dish pairs wonderfully with white rice, brown rice, or even quinoa for a healthy twist. You can also serve it alongside steamed broccoli or stir-fried vegetables for a vibrant and colorful plate.
